MMP Consultancy are working with a fantastic organisation to recruit a Contracts Officer to join them on a Permanent basis in Kent.

Please note this position will be working 3 days from home.

Key Responsibilities:

To co-ordinate the day to day running of the contract, encompassing the planning of works and managing the performance and delivery to the required contract specification. Assisting the Senior Contract Manager where necessary to deliver the requirements of the Contract. Have a focus on safety first with all risks identified immediately escalated to the Senior Contract Manager. Provide regular updates and support to Senior Contract Manager on contracts outcomes against programme. Undertake regular audit of contract related information. Collate, analyse, monitor and report on KPIs within the contractual frameworks. Provide financial Monitoring support and analysis to Senior Contract manager. Regular monitoring of CRM Task Management. Monitor and report on contract management meeting actions. Take on specific projects as required. Support delivery teams in responding to written and phone enquiries and update CRM as necessary. Processing works orders, completions, process for payments or inspection requests in accordance with the policies and procedures and respond to general queries relating to proposed and confirmed works. Assist in the provision of information for the database for Stock Condition, Asbestos, Fire Risk Assessment and any other areas as required. Carry out other support tasks such as word processing, processing correspondence, specifications and providing general support to the Property Team. Manage a budget of £150K per contract and works associated with it. Undertake any other duties to meet the requirements of the role.

Requirements: Proven project management or contract experience. Detailed knowledge of using a variety of JCT and partnering contracts. Ability to communicate and influence contractors, colleagues and other stakeholders. Proven influencing and negotiating skills to resolve problems. Sound judgement and prioritisation skills. Ability to work within tight deadlines, under pressure and deliver projects on time, within budget and to the required standard. Experience of dealing effectively with customer complaints and able to demonstrate an understanding of what provides excellent customer service. The ability to work as part of a team, along with the ability to prioritise the workload of self and others.
